Matthew Pavlich signs off from 9News Perth

9News Perth sport presenter, Fremantle Dockers legend and AFL Hall of Famer Matthew Pavlich will present his final bulletin on 9News 6.00 with Michael Thomson this Thursday, October 16.

 

In his seven years with the Nine network, Pavlich has been a key figure on 9News 6.00, from the AFL’s biggest clashes to live coverage at the Paris Olympics in 2024.

It made him a fan favourite with sharp insight and on-air presence, a trusted voice in sport reporting nationwide.

The AFL great is opening a bold new chapter in his career, stepping into the role of CEO at the Sydney Swans.

9News Perth’s News Director, Michael Genovese, said: “Pav has brought professionalism, passion and presence to every bulletin. He’ll be missed by our newsroom and our viewers.”

Pavlich said: “It has been an incredible ride with 9News Perth. I’m grateful for the opportunities and proud of what we’ve achieved. Now I’m excited for the next challenge.”

Viewers can watch Pavlich’s last sport bulletin live during 9News at 6.00 on Thursday.

As previously announced in August, Pavlich is departing Nine to take over from Tom Harley as the Sydney Swans’ Chief Executive Officer.
